Tomato Pie

1 pre-baked pie shell

Spread 2 Tablespoons or so of any kind of mustard you like on baked pie shell crust.

Place 1 layer of sliced tomatoes in bottom of crust. (I also added some sliced Vidalia onions on top of the tomatoes but you don't have to).

Sprinkle the 1st layer of tomatoes with a layer of cheese..any kind you like. I used a mixture of shredded cheeses like you buy in the store already pre-packaged.

Place another layer of tomatoes on top of that...sprinkle with (onions if you want again) and then another layer of cheese.  Work your way to the top of the pie crust.

You end with cheese layer.

For the topping you can mix 1/2 cup of mayo and 1/2 cup of Parmesan cheese..spread over cheese and tomato layers. (You do not have to use this last step ..it is super rich...but it makes it good...but you can just have your last layer cheese or maybe top with bacon bits or something). If you need more you can always increase the mayo another 1/4 cup and same for Parmesan cheese...

Bake in 350 to 375 degree oven for about 15 to 20 minutes..till golden brown and bubbly on top.

Cool slightly so juice will set up some...slice and enjoy!

Spicy Chicken Tacos...

and I do admit they were very good although I did change the recipe a bit. Here is the recipe:

1 Tablespoon extra virgin olive oil (once around the pan)
1-1/2 pounds boneless skinless chicken breasts cut into very small cubes
1 small onion chopped
1 clove garlic minced
1 cup tomato puree
2 teaspoons chili powder
1 teaspoon ground cumin (I left this out)
handful of coarsely chopped Spanish olives with pimentos (I did not use so many)
a handful of golden raisins (I also left this out)
coarse salt to taste
8 jumbo corn taco shells or flour tortillas for soft tacos

Toppings:
Shredded cheeses, onions tomatoes, lettuce, avocadoes

Heat a big skillet over medium heat, add olive oil and chicken and cook till chicken is brown. Add onion and garlic and cook till onion is soft. Add tomato puree, and spices and olives. (raisins too if you are adding them). Bring to bubble and reduce heat to keep warm till ready to serve.

Toast/warm taco shells according to package instructions.

Scoop filling into shells or tortillas and top with your favorite toppings.
